Akhi Boy
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: AH-kee //ˈɑːki//
Origin: Arabic; Hindi; Hebrew
Meaning: brother (Arabic); beloved (Hindi); brother (Hebrew)
Historical & Cultural Background
The name Akhi has its roots in the Hebrew language, where it is derived from the word "אח" (ach), meaning "brother." This term has been a significant part of Hebrew culture and language, symbolizing familial bonds and kinship. The transition of the name into English can be traced through the historical interactions between Hebrew and other languages, particularly during the periods of the Babylonian Exile and the subsequent Hellenistic influence, which introduced Hebrew terms into Greek and later into Latin and other European languages.
The name Akhi, while not commonly used in English-speaking contexts, retains its original meaning and significance in Hebrew-speaking communities. Historically, the concept of brotherhood is deeply embedded in various religious texts, including the Hebrew Bible, where numerous figures exemplify the importance of brotherly relationships.
For instance, the story of Cain and Abel highlights the complexities of brotherhood, while the bond between David and Jonathan illustrates loyalty and friendship. These narratives have contributed to the cultural resonance of names related to brotherhood, including Akhi, throughout Jewish history.
The name may not be directly mentioned in major translations like the King James Bible, but the underlying themes of brotherhood are prevalent in many biblical stories. Culturally, the name Akhi embodies values of loyalty, support, and familial ties, which are significant in many societies.
In Jewish tradition, names often carry deep meanings and are chosen to reflect the qualities parents wish to impart to their children. The enduring nature of names associated with familial relationships, such as Akhi, underscores the importance of these values across generations.
While diminutive forms or variations of the name may exist, Akhi itself remains a poignant reminder of the significance of brotherhood in both historical and cultural contexts.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Akhi was first seen in the United States in 2011.
Akhi has ranked as high as #1416 nationally, which occurred in 2016, and has been most popular in .
In the past 5 years the name Akhi has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
